Primality and Factorization

241788 is a composite number, meaning it has divisors other than 1 and itself. Specifically, 241788 has 12 divisors: 1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 12, 20149, 40298, 60447, 80596, 120894, 241788. The sum of its proper divisors (all divisors except 241788 itself) is 322412, which makes 241788 an abundant number, since 322412 > 241788. Abundant numbers are integers where the sum of proper divisors exceeds the number.

The prime factorization of 241788 is 2 × 2 × 3 × 20149. Prime factorization is essential for computing the greatest common divisor (GCD) and least common multiple (LCM), simplifying fractions, and solving problems in modular arithmetic. The nearest primes to 241788 are 241783 and 241793.

Digit Properties

The digits of 241788 sum to 30, and its digital root (the single-digit value obtained by repeatedly summing digits) is 3. The number 241788 has 6 digits in its decimal representation. Digit sums are fundamental to divisibility tests: a number is divisible by 3 if and only if its digit sum is divisible by 3, and the same holds for divisibility by 9. The digital root, also known as the repeated digital sum, has applications in casting out nines — a centuries-old technique for verifying arithmetic calculations.

Collatz Conjecture

The Collatz conjecture (also known as the 3n + 1 problem) is one of the most famous unsolved problems in mathematics. Starting from 241788 and repeatedly applying the rule — divide by 2 if even, multiply by 3 and add 1 if odd — the sequence reaches 1 in 119 steps. Despite its simplicity, no one has been able to prove that this process always terminates for every starting number, and the conjecture remains open since it was first proposed by Lothar Collatz in 1937.

Goldbach’s Conjecture

According to Goldbach’s conjecture, every even integer greater than 2 can be expressed as the sum of two prime numbers. For 241788, one such partition is 5 + 241783 = 241788. This conjecture, proposed in 1742 by Christian Goldbach in a letter to Leonhard Euler, has been verified computationally for all even numbers up to at least 4 × 1018, but a general proof remains elusive.
